Are you wondering if your crush is losing interest in you? It can be challenging to know for sure, but there are some tell-tale signs that he’s not into you anymore.
Signs He Doesn’t Like You Anymore
Lack of Communication
Communication is the foundation of any relationship. If he’s not speaking to you, it’s a clear sign that he’s not interested in maintaining the relationship. No matter how busy his schedule is, if he likes you, he will make time for you.
He Doesn’t Reply to Your Texts
If he’s not responding to your texts, it could mean he’s not interested in you. If you’re struggling to get his attention, it’s time to move on. Texting is a quick way to communicate, so if he’s not responding, it’s likely that he’s ignoring you.
He Doesn’t Ask You to Hang Out
When he’s no longer interested in spending time together, it’s a sign that things are fading. If he’s not making plans with you anymore or always has other things to do, it’s a sign he’s not interested in spending time with you.
He’s M.I.A.
He’s vanished off the face of the earth, and you can’t get hold of him. If he’s gone missing in action, it’s a sign he’s lost interest in you.

Have you ever been in a situation where you are unsure if a guy is still interested in you or not? It can be difficult to know for sure, but there are some signs to look out for that could signal he’s lost interest.
Distancing
The most prominent sign that a guy has lost interest is that he starts to distance himself. He may not call you as often, cancel plans more frequently, or be less enthusiastic when you’re together. If you notice a decrease in communication or you’re the only one initiating contact, it could be a red flag that he’s losing interest.
Warning Signals
Other warning signs to look out for can include less physical contact between you two, fewer compliments, or you’re keeping everything about the relationship superficial and friendly. These signs could be a sign that the relationship is losing its romance and is no longer heading in a promising direction.
Humiliation of Waiting to be Dumped
Waiting for someone else to end the relationship is humiliating and disempowering. You’re left feeling like you’re begging for their attention, and they’re not reciprocating or respecting your feelings. It’s important to understand that this situation can create unnecessary feelings of inadequacy that can leave you feeling low.
Pushing Harder Makes Them Run Away
Pushing harder to maintain someone’s interest doesn’t work. If someone is backing away from you and you respond by becoming more demanding or persistent, you risk alienating them further. It smacks of desperation, which is a big turn-off for most people.
